In Greek mythology, which Titans forged thunderbolts for Zeus?

In Greek mythology, the Titans who forged thunderbolts for Zeus were known as the Cyclopes. These powerful beings were giant, one-eyed creatures who possessed incredible strength and skill in craftsmanship. The Cyclopes were the sons of Uranus and Gaia, and they were renowned for their ability to create powerful weapons and tools.

According to the myth, Zeus freed the Cyclopes from their imprisonment in Tartarus as a gesture of gratitude for their assistance in the Titanomachy, the great war between the Titans and the Olympian gods. In return for their freedom, the Cyclopes forged thunderbolts for Zeus, which became one of his most iconic symbols of power and authority.

The thunderbolts created by the Cyclopes were said to be imbued with the power of lightning, making them incredibly destructive and capable of striking down even the mightiest foes. Zeus used these thunderbolts as weapons in battle, unleashing their power to defeat his enemies and assert his dominance over the heavens.

Throughout Greek mythology, the thunderbolt became a symbol of Zeus's authority and control over the natural world. It represented his mastery of the forces of nature and his ability to wield immense power with just a single gesture. The thunderbolts forged by the Cyclopes were a testament to Zeus's strength and the loyalty of his allies.
